Petzl Attache Screw-Lock Carabiner

One of the leading locking carabiners on the market, the Petzl Attache Screw-Lock Carabiner is designed for easy use when belaying. The compact pear shape facilitates belaying single ropes with a Munter hitch, and is enhanced with a snag-free Keylock gate system. Lightweight and smooth to handle, the Attache simply makes belaying easier.

  • Designed for use when belaying
  • Lightweight and compact, easy to handle
  • Pear shaped facilitates belaying single ropes with a Munter hitch
  • Keylock System (snag-free body / gate interface)
  • CREW-LOCK manual locking system
  • Strength: 23 kN. long axis, 6 kN open gate, 7 kN. short axis
  • CE - 80 g.

Excellent 'locker
The Attache is a fantastic locking biner. The 'Red You're Dead' markings on the gate of the carabiner is great for visual confirmation. Another nice feature of the carabiner is that I have experienced minimal cross-loading of the biner in my GriGri when belaying, which is an added safety feature. It still cross-loads sometimes, but much less than with any other 'biner I've used. Fantastic size, shape, and weight.
